Exploring Key Aspects of "Eligh" Pronunciation

1. Potential Etymological Roots: The spelling "Eligh" doesn't directly match common names in widely known languages. However, its phonetic similarity to names like Elijah (Hebrew origin), Elias (Greek origin), or Eli (Hebrew origin) suggests possible connections. Further research into less common names or family-specific naming traditions could potentially reveal a more definitive origin. Without a definitive historical record, the etymology remains speculative.

2. Phonetic Interpretations: The lack of a standardized pronunciation for "Eligh" opens the door to several phonetic possibilities. The most likely interpretations, based on similar-sounding names, include:

  • EE-ligh: This pronunciation emphasizes the long "E" sound, as in "see," followed by a stressed "ligh" syllable.
  • EL-igh: This interpretation treats "Eli" as a separate syllable, similar to the name "Eli," followed by a short "igh" sound.
  • EH-ligh: This version uses a shorter "E" sound, like in "bed," followed by the "ligh" syllable.

3. Determining the Correct Pronunciation: Because the name is not widely used, the only reliable method to determine the correct pronunciation is to directly ask the individual who uses the name. This approach shows respect for their personal identity and preferences and avoids potentially embarrassing mispronunciations.

4. The Significance of Correct Pronunciation: Correct pronunciation demonstrates respect for the individual, their heritage, and the significance of their name. Mispronouncing a name can be perceived as dismissive or even offensive, underscoring the importance of careful consideration and, if unsure, direct inquiry.

FAQ Section

1. How do I politely ask someone how to pronounce their name? A simple and direct approach is best: "I'm not sure how to pronounce your name, could you tell me please?" This avoids awkwardness and shows respect.

2. What if I accidentally mispronounce someone's name? A sincere apology is crucial: "I'm so sorry, I mispronounced your name. Could you please tell me again how to say it correctly?"

3. Is it important to learn the origin of a name before trying to pronounce it? While understanding the origin can be interesting, the most important thing is to ask the individual how they pronounce their name.

4. Are there any resources to help me learn proper name pronunciations? Online dictionaries, language learning apps, and even social media can provide guidance, though confirmation from the individual remains essential.

5. How can I remember someone's name and pronunciation? Write it down, repeat it back to confirm, and actively try to use it correctly in conversations.

6. What are the cultural implications of mispronouncing a name? It can be perceived as disrespectful, showing a lack of awareness and care for the individual and their background.

Practical Tips for Pronouncing Uncommon Names

  1. Always ask: The primary and most reliable method is directly asking the individual.
  2. Listen carefully: Pay attention to their pronunciation and repeat it back to ensure you understand correctly.
  3. Write it down: Note the pronunciation phonetically if needed to aid in memorization.
  4. Practice: Repeat the name to yourself to reinforce proper pronunciation.
  5. Use the name: Incorporate the name into conversations to build familiarity and reinforce your memory.
  6. Don't be afraid to ask again: If unsure, politely ask for clarification; it is better to ask than to continue mispronouncing.
  7. Be mindful of cultural nuances: Some names have specific cultural pronunciations that may differ from what might be inferred from spelling.
  8. Use online resources judiciously: While helpful, online resources are not a substitute for directly asking the individual.
